Home
last modified time | relevance | path

Searched refs:ibi_lock (Results 1 – 3 of 3) sorted by relevance

/openbmc/linux/drivers/i3c/
H A Ddevice.c109 mutex_lock(&dev->desc->ibi_lock); in i3c_device_disable_ibi()
111 mutex_unlock(&dev->desc->ibi_lock); in i3c_device_disable_ibi()
138 mutex_lock(&dev->desc->ibi_lock); in i3c_device_enable_ibi()
140 mutex_unlock(&dev->desc->ibi_lock); in i3c_device_enable_ibi()
169 mutex_lock(&dev->desc->ibi_lock); in i3c_device_request_ibi()
171 mutex_unlock(&dev->desc->ibi_lock); in i3c_device_request_ibi()
191 mutex_lock(&dev->desc->ibi_lock); in i3c_device_free_ibi()
193 mutex_unlock(&dev->desc->ibi_lock); in i3c_device_free_ibi()
H A Dmaster.c790 mutex_init(&dev->ibi_lock); in i3c_master_alloc_i3c_dev()
1943 mutex_lock(&olddev->ibi_lock); in i3c_master_add_i3c_dev_locked()
1956 mutex_unlock(&olddev->ibi_lock); in i3c_master_add_i3c_dev_locked()
2008 mutex_lock(&newdev->ibi_lock); in i3c_master_add_i3c_dev_locked()
2021 mutex_unlock(&newdev->ibi_lock); in i3c_master_add_i3c_dev_locked()
/openbmc/linux/include/linux/i3c/
H A Dmaster.h216 struct mutex ibi_lock; member